Sales Planning Manager
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Job Purpose:
To monitor, optimize sales planning from different sales segments and assist the sales management by identifying areas of improvements.
Key Responsibilities:
- Monitor and ensure that the orders of all products are in line with the market demand to control wastage
- & optimize sales
- Manage the process of loading from sales part and volume distribution between the channels and customers.
- Optimize sales allocation and the system model and ensure adherence to the model.
- Optimize sales forecast accuracy.
- Prepare the sales demand for production on daily basis based on the capacity constraints.
- Prepare the allocation to adhere to the product mix.
- Monitor inventory level identifying potential stock out or oversupply.
- Collaborate with Regional heads, channel heads, product managers to improve the plan accuracy.
- Optimize and ensure adherence to all sales plans.
- Initial approval for the promotion requests related to the supply availability.
- Involve in the annual business plan for the department aligned with management.
- Review the volume plan with Business planning department.
Key Relationships
- Sales (Area & National Managers).
- Marketing (Product Managers).
- Business Planning.
- Finance.
- Material Management.
- Corporate Shared Services.
Working Environment:
Office-based role, collaborating closely with cross-functional teams.
Decision-Making Authority
- Sales volume & asset distribution.
- Promotion requests approvals.
Qualifications & Skills
-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business Management, or related field.
- Strong analytical and data-driven mindset.
- Proven stakeholder management experience.
- Ability to identify and drive improvements.
- Highly detail-oriented with strong problem-solving skills.
- Team player with excellent collaboration abilities.
Experience
3–8 years of experience in sales, planning, or business development.

Sales Management Director
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Company: Hisham Al Baloushi Group
Reporting to: Group CEO
Key Responsibilities:
Develop and implement strategic and annual sales management plans for the food distribution and wholesale sector, with oversight of real estate sales when required.
Lead and manage sales teams (supervisors and representatives) to ensure achievement of monthly and annual sales targets.
Grow and strengthen the network of existing clients, while expanding the base of active and recurring customers across the Kingdom and beyond.
Continuously monitor market trends and competitors, proposing effective strategies to increase market share of the Group's products and private labels.
Negotiate and close strategic contracts with key accounts to secure sustainable growth.
Prepare and submit accurate performance reports (we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ual) to executive management.
Oversee pricing strategies, promotional activities, and distribution channels.
Ensure proper collection of receivables in line with company policies.
Train, coach, and motivate sales teams to achieve maximum performance.
Qualifications and Experience:
Proven 7–10 years of solid experience in Sales Management within the FMCG and food distribution sector.
Demonstrated track record in leading sales teams and consistently achieving monthly and annual targets.
Strong client network within the food & beverage sector across Saudi Arabia and internationally.
Fluency in English (written and spoken) is a must.
Additional experience in real estate sales is a plus.
Skills:
Strong leadership and team motivation.
Strategic and operational planning.
Excellent negotiation and persuasion skills.
Strong communication skills in Arabic and English.
Ability to work under pressure and willingness to travel domestically and internationally.
KPIs:
Achievement of monthly and annual sales targets.
Growth rate of sales in food products.
Increase in the number of active and recurring customers.
Expansion of geographic coverage within the Kingdom.
Timely and accurate submission of periodic reports.

Business Development
Posted 2 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
The Senior Manager role at the company is mission critical and requires multi-dimensional capabilities – Business Development, Account Management and Practice Development.
Senior Managers identify business opportunities within their immediate client’s business or across an industry. They are responsible for growing existing accounts and attracting new business. Managers develop a deep understanding of client’s business and build lasting relationships with client personnel. They demonstrate technical competence in their product group and industry, understand client’s perspective and become the de-facto “go-to-person”.
They are responsible for developing business, serving clients and ensuring outstanding quality execution of projects. Managers develop contacts within the business community and serve as ambassadors of the company in the market. Basis their credibility, they are able to attract and retain the best of talent.
Role RequirementsSome of the key responsibilities of this role are:
- Providing expertise and professional advice to the client organizations on effective implementation of Capital Projects program and deliver value from Capital projects
- Develop strong relationships with top executives at prospects (target clients) and existing clients.
- Identify the value we will be providing to clients. Collaborate on resource staffing to maximize value for the firm.
- Understand the client’s requirements and develop effective proposals and any other collateral required.
- Ensure firm is included in responses to key industry and solution RFP’s in the region.
- Build a strong network of contacts and leverage it for business development.
- Speak at/ chair local/regional conferences and initiate exploratory meetings with prospective clients.
- Develop relationships with key buyers and hunt for opportunities to expand our relationship network.
- Conduct interviews with clients (senior staff – CXOs & heads of business units), analyze the facts, establish hypotheses and derive conclusions.
- Supervise a team of professionals across different client engagements. Ensure delivery of quality work in line with our value proposition. Demonstrate technical competence in related domain. Oversee billing and collections.
- Prepare client presentations (for different target audiences – CXOs, Board of Directors, Audit Committees). Lead presentations on assignment reports &/ project deliverables to client management.
-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ering with relevant discipline (e.g. Mechanical, Electrical, Civil, Construction etc.) or Architecture.
- Master’s in Business Administration (Finance, Strategy, Operations, and General Management).
- Experience of working in a senior position of any leading consulting firms in the region with focus on Capital Projects Advisory, including dispute resolution.
- Candidate with Minimum 10 years of industry related / relevant consulting experience with in-depth understanding of the Capital Projects domain. Key areas of expertise expected include project management, cost estimation, quantity surveying, budgeting and accounting.
- Understanding of project controls, QA/QC, contract administration, procurement and construction / project risk management.
- Exposure to diverse industries including Real Estate, Contracting, Infrastructure, Oil & Gas and industrial projects.
- Must have strong local/regional community network and be an active member of trade and professional associations.
- A good blend of creative thinking and rigorous analysis in solving business problems.
- High energy individual possessing excellent analytical, interpersonal, communication and presentation skills. Adept at preparing and presenting to senior audiences.
- Demonstrates excellent leadership and interpersonal skills. Must be able to maintain a professional demeanor in times of high stress.
- Prior management and direct supervisory experience in a team environment required.
- Excellent time management skills. Must have ability to multi-task.
- Regular reading habits to stay abreast of new trends & developments and exhibit high level of confidentiality.
- Enjoys travelling and meeting new people. Flexibility to travel to, and work in, other locations is essential.
Selected personnel will be based out of our Saudi Arabia office.
